Onions and shallots, green — Gross Production Value in South-Eastern Asia
South-Eastern Asia: Onions and shallots, green — Gross Production Value was 95,897 1000 USD in 2024. ◆ Volatile
Onions and shallots, green — Gross Production Value in South-Eastern Asia, 1961–2024
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ations. Measured in 1000 USD.
Analysis
South-Eastern Asia recorded 95,897 1000 USD for onions and shallots, green — gross production value in 2024.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 0.6% on the previous year and up 36.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, onions and shallots, green — gross production value in South-Eastern Asia peaked at 124,518 1000 USD in 2004 and was at its lowest, 404 1000 USD, in 1998.
That places South-Eastern Asia 12th out of 22 groups with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
